Does what you say about your brand match what your people say about your brand?

To become an organization that top talent wants to work for — and stay with — a strong employer brand will set you apart.  But the brands that people are most attracted to don’t behave like brands at all.

They’re more human than anything. Not too perfect, not too staged. Like a photo without a filter, they’re real and authentic.

The demand for authenticity isn’t coming from employees alone. In fact, 90% of customers say authenticity is important when choosing which brands they buy from, and 64% have stopped purchasing a product after learning that a company treats its employees poorly.

As the line blurs between your employer brand and your corporate brand, it’s time to look at your talent strategy through the dual perspectives of marketing and HR.
